Assistant Professor of Civil Engineering

Dr. Ayhan Irfanoglu joins Purdue University as an Assistant Professor of Civil Engineering in the structures group. His research interests include development of conceptual and practical frameworks for performance-based structural design and evaluation, uncertainty modeling and rational decision-making in engineering, earthquake and blast engineering, modal testing and analysis, structural health-monitoring, large-scale structural analysis and simulation, and engineering seismology. He graduated from the Middle East Technical University in Turkey, with a bachelors degree in civil engineering and completed both his masters and doctoral programs at California Institute of Technology in civil engineering. After his Ph.D. in 2000, he served as an engineer for a nationwide engineering consulting company, Wiss, Janney, Elstner Associates, Inc. in California. Dr. Irfanoglu has also been a team member in evaluating and providing technical support for the Bingol earthquake, May 2003, the Kocaeli earthquake, August 1999, and the Northridge earthquake, January 1994.
